Ethiopia Historical Route – By Air- 8 Days
Itinerary
Ethiopia Historical Route – By Air Day 1: Arrival in Addis Ababa The name of the capital city of Ethiopia in Amharic (the national language of Ethiopia) means “New flower”. Addis, which was founded in 1886 by Menelik II, is located at 2,500 meters above sea level in one of the highest parts of Entoto mountain chain (3,000 meters above sea level). It enjoys an excellent climate all year round, with an average temperature of 25şC. Addis Ababa is a pleasant city with side avenues of jacaranda Trees, interesting museums and one of the largest open-air markets in Africa, known as the “Merkato”. Day 2: Addis Ababa – Lalibela In the morning, transfer to Airport to leave for Lalibela which used to be called Roha until the end of 12th century. Lalibela is located at an altitude of 2,600 meters above sea level. Today the little town of Lalibela embraced the remarkably excavated 12th century eleven rock hewn churches that are registered as one of the world wonders. As the city contains 11 monolithic churches that were built in the twelfth century and carved out of the pink granite rock; each church has a Unique architectural style: all are superbly carved and most of then are decorated with well-preserved paintings. The entire city may be described as a sculpture dedicated to the glory of God. Dinner and overnight stay in a hotel: in the evening you may attend a show featuring traditional dance. While in Axum, you visit the Archeological museum, the Zion Cathedral where the original Arc of the covenant is still found, the stele park where the magnificent single block of stones erected since the 3rd century, the ruin palace and Bath of Queen Sheba who was the mother of king Menelik I of the 950 BC and tombs of the early century Kings. O/n Yeha hotel Day 5: Axum - Gondar Gondar was the first capital city of the Ethiopian empire, which began in 1632 with the reign of Fasilidas. In the city, there are a dozen castles built by various emperors over the course of 236 years. The city seems more European than African and also has Islamic influences. In the afternoon, we visit the palaces, residences and baths of Fasilidas; afterwards, we visit the church of Debre Berhan Selassie (Light of the Trinity), which is located at the summit of a hill and surrounded by fortified walls. The interior is decorated with beautiful frescos. Dinner and overnight stay are in a hotel with a splendid panoramic garden, Goha Hotel. Then drive to the waterfalls of the Blue Nile: 100m wide, the water plunges for 45 meters, giving rise to steam clouds and rainbows. Those who wish may descend to the base of the falls, climb back up the other side and cross the Nile in a papyrus boat (traditionally known as a “Tankwas”) in order to return to the point of departure (about an hour’s walk). Day 7: Bahir Dar There are 37 islands on the lake and 30 of them have churches and monasteries of considerable historical and cultural interest. The morning set for a boat trip on the lake to explore some of the islands and a walk is organized on one of them like that of Ura Kidanemihret, Kibran Gebriel, and Azewa Mariam to see mural paintings, crowns, crosses etc. On the way back to Bahir Dar see place where the Blue Nile River and Lake Tana join.
